Kevin Phillips has shared his instant reaction to West Brom handing their job to Steve Bruce on Thursday evening.

The ex-Baggies talisman has urged the former Newcastle man to change his philosophy to bring attacking football back to The Hawthorns.

Bruce has been given an 18-month deal and has already admitted that promotion to the Premier League is his only job.

West Brom

“It doesn’t surprise me,” he exclusively told West Brom News.

“The West Brom fans, they’ve had to watch some tough games this year, we’ve all associated West Brom with free-flowing attacking football and that’s what they have been used to, it hasn’t happened a lot this season.

“Steve to come in, maybe he has to change the philosophy to be more attacking because he was labelled as more a defensive person at Newcastle, which I thought was harsh. No surprise.”
